Appellate court upholds fine for ex-President Moon's daughter in DUI case
SEOUL, Feb. 5 (Yonhap) -- A court of appeals on Thursday upheld a lower court's ruling that sentenced the daughter of former President Moon Jae-in to a fine of 15 million won (US$10,200) on charges of drunk driving and illegally operating an Airbnb business.
The appellate division of the Seoul Western District Court handed down the sentence for Moon Da-hye, saying that no new circumstances can be found to warrant a change in her initial sentence.
The younger Moon, 43, is accused of driving her car into a taxi while trying to change lanes in Seoul's Itaewon district in October 2024. Her blood alcohol concentration was measured at 0.149 percent at the time, exceeding the 0.08 percent threshold for driver's license revocation.
Separately, she is accused of running an Airbnb business without official registration at two locations in Seoul's Yeongdeungpo district and one on the southern resort island of Jeju.
Prosecutors demanded a one-year prison term for her in the previous appeal trial last November.
